"Getting to Know Homo Sapiens"
Situated among the lush Park zur Katz that used to be Zürich's Botanical Gardens, the Anthropological Museum of the University of Zürich shows "treasures of a kind, as you wouldn't expect in this area." The list of countries from which the museum shows objects and rare documents in its permanent exhibition is long: Africa, Tibet and the Himalayas, China, Japan, Indonesia, Sumatra, Borneo, Java, Bali, India, Ceylon and Thailand, America and Oceania. Further, Völkerkundemuseum holds various special exhibitions and has its own library. All this makes a visit to the museum seem like a giant step outside your known environment.
